aboutsummaryrefslogtreecommitdiffstats
AgeCommit message (Collapse)AuthorFilesLines
2018-03-14Add vfc-catalog UUID non-null protectionying.yunlong1-1/+2
For openo csars, there is no UUID, only has id, so when UUID is not null, replace id with UUID. Change-Id: I437dbb6dbb2291a223de2981ae830bab46316d37 Issue-ID: VFC-810 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-03-03Fix GPL license problems for vfc-nfvo-catalogfujinhua2-1/+4
Change Mysql connector to PyMySQL Change-Id: I30482af9aa12c3a9249259fa3cff213f79d2d283 Issue-ID: VFC-787 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2018-03-02Add Sonar coverage for vfc-nfvo-catalogfujinhua3-1/+142
Change-Id: Ib55c4777613792f316977b886e0243d263a31d53 Issue-ID: VFC-782 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2018-03-01Fix vfc-catalog license issueying.yunlong1-0/+0
Change-Id: I4e2c34a07bf9542554f3d72234491ff54fb8801d Issue-ID: VFC-780 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-12Modify vfc-catalog parser unittestsying.yunlong2-3/+5
Change-Id: Ib3ea7a04dabf366ea171efa2f16ce330d6ff50db Issue-ID: VFC-758 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-12Add vfc-catalog parser testsying.yunlong3-1/+33
Change-Id: I55c9de74cdadb5f9cbb58f728905bc8de7cc5519 Issue-ID: VFC-758 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2018-02-11Modify requirements of pip installfengyuanxing1-8/+0
Change-Id: I2dd2a119f85b78172f228b36c4548a4cc5e27800 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-11Fix Django Invalid HTTP_HOST header problemfujinhua1-1/+1
Change-Id: I643799fa5498af22f99c6c89f84a70b2d5ec517f Issue-ID: VFC-756 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2018-02-09Modify return status code of swagger.jsonfengyuanxing1-3/+3
Change-Id: I66d59dd89fcd57db9affe655d0a0d5f6eca70cd5 Issue-ID: VFC-750 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-09Modify return status code of deleting ns packagefengyuanxing2-3/+3
Change-Id: I699028c9b9caa46ef65ae0f93638f32c70b9c80c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-09Modify return object of deleting ns packagefengyuanxing1-4/+1
Change-Id: I28b07416484f79c380feede1e95d211dea944159 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-09Modify swagger json for getting packagesfengyuanxing1-6/+0
Change-Id: Ic4c3cf9c36230e7f89531eecfd999dc19910a741 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-09Modify swagger code for ns packagefengyuanxing2-5/+8
Change-Id: I439515f8b21ff7acc2c2126a7e4d83a8ec920ed7 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-09Add description codefengyuanxing1-2/+2
Change-Id: I5008fd498359b3e47737177c9946211111db9417 Issue-ID: VFC-750 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-09Add post job swaggerfengyuanxing1-0/+48
Change-Id: I2906e93b606a38a9df047f73319879546cf7a596 Issue-ID: VFC-750 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-09Modify the return codefengyuanxing1-1/+1
Change-Id: I2d39e41dbe651410c6d9bc01721803d584e097e8 Issue-ID: VFC-750 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-01LICENSE file addedajay priyadarshi1-0/+15
Added License File in vfc-catalog for CII badge Application file name: LICENSE Change-Id: I0c90d83d8bb29e258a3c55b0089dfa979150653c Issue-ID: VFC-717 Signed-off-by: ajay priyadarshi <ajay.priyadarshi@ril.com>
2018-02-01Remove unused exception codefengyuanxing1-44/+32
Change-Id: I1264b1045ab4d526e9b3b5c74f47ada3cf329cfc Issue-ID: VFC-677 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-01Refactor code for validation in job swaggerfengyuanxing1-24/+28
Change-Id: I5bce9de938329a2f57f0120d4e0c92ff779061bf Issue-ID: VFC-677 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-02-01Refactor schema names for job swaggerfengyuanxing2-10/+10
Change-Id: I786d13be423c74e608a5c2d26952071fae164720 Issue-ID: VFC-677 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-30Add swagger validation code for ns packagefengyuanxing1-1/+6
Change-Id: Ia18a1efe546ab20ba01d14ddf012d2ae4a357d32 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-30Add swagger code for ns packagefengyuanxing1-0/+36
Change-Id: I6f1cccd018bdb02f370a4d198a3a36c0173acdf8 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-30Modify code of distributing ns packagefengyuanxing1-1/+7
Change-Id: Ib5660be880ebfe3bf244665dc1f346a5b3219458 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-30Add validation code of deleting/getting nf packagefengyuanxing1-37/+55
Change-Id: Ic7f14b888c8f40a5e5fa05aeea168946f3fff66e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-29Add code for swagger of delete/get nf packagefengyuanxing1-2/+45
Change-Id: I1a1432c072bd09d87f371a385059ef87b4d00966 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-29Refact code dealing with errorsfengyuanxing2-22/+54
Change-Id: Ib61c68a5a9a58e2208181d5c70c6ff75b2ccb22b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-29Modify incorrect schema of internal errorfengyuanxing2-24/+12
Change-Id: I1bc0922a5d363e1da19f2f16695d0a22e01718ea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-29Modify incorrect schema of parsing model swaggerfengyuanxing2-4/+8
Change-Id: I78bdb667c039b2271e1e08acca2580a3fb715daa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-29Add code for swagger of parsing ns modelfengyuanxing1-1/+11
Change-Id: Id1982209edf7391374ac48f9b6417d61ff8a55ae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-29Modify the incorrect response status codefengyuanxing1-5/+5
Change-Id: I83b2a276932e10cf384ea459a30e99182516b48b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-29Add code for swager of parsing nf modelfengyuanxing1-3/+15
Change-Id: I4f65bf0ddb3ed2ab833653720e9295ec3f76dde3 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-29Add code for response validationfengyuanxing1-9/+19
Change-Id: If6fb6c5baa939cfc5f94938cf9f12ba474e750db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-26Modify schema object adding allow-blankfengyuanxing1-12/+39
Change-Id: I2da2f93d90c14d8664c4b0fa7ab1b35c1b738085 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-26Add validation codefengyuanxing3-23/+30
Change-Id: I37591d5c4300cff28cf2fcc6a54109979300c711 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-26Modify the incorrect field namesfengyuanxing1-2/+2
Change-Id: I451c300b15bca0a73c97ec0b19f9835d395414db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-26Add swagger code for nf packagesfengyuanxing1-0/+24
Change-Id: I3af5b46d5541294054c46c182239c91fc0f30f46 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-26Modify code for swagger return msgfengyuanxing1-2/+1
Change-Id: I04b81f584dc4248e16efd1bc9d38f2b554923994 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-26Refactor code adding functon to deal with errorfengyuanxing2-10/+32
Change-Id: Iece103a960de2fb36aa20ceace5a102c5f1254d1 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-26Refactor code for pep8fengyuanxing1-411/+297
Change-Id: I861d68a016891a6cd14e9c3860000a83778134a5 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-26Modify hard code for packagesfengyuanxing1-4/+4
Change-Id: I86dfe1c64337aecf8c76fe17d544238e8729a110 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-26Add swagger code for packagesfengyuanxing1-12/+77
Change-Id: Ied632964c69ccb14beaa61982789c3053213deca Issue-ID: VFC-685 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-25Add validataion code of swagger codefengyuanxing2-6/+16
Change-Id: I5e829afc6fe55ccfc44b8ef8d2fae9db888f28ac Issue-ID: VFC-677 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-25Add validataion code of swagger codefengyuanxing1-4/+22
Change-Id: I9ffe176e3890476c627f75b7de5d4563f7123df2 Issue-ID: VFC-677 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-25Fix incorrect class of swagger code.fengyuanxing2-6/+8
Change-Id: I355481443e12466af8b964eb819f26fd0e006c20 Issue-ID: VFC-677 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-25Modify the help text of swaggerfengyuanxing1-33/+44
Change-Id: I9bb7697b704efdf1e4f209a9d0295947d3d912c0 Issue-ID: VFC-677 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-25Modify the help text of swaggerfengyuanxing1-18/+18
Change-Id: Ifd895dcf3d735d0f54c87db71cc42a61c87dacba Issue-ID: VFC-677 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-25Add status code for job viewsfengyuanxing1-3/+3
Change-Id: Id7e1826dd1f33b4235896671960f6142cc4ffea7 Issue-ID: VFC-684 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-25Modify hard code to status constantsfengyuanxing1-3/+4
Change-Id: Ib61211f3c3f8d8ddf33b3d8873ce642ad72462f5 Issue-ID: VFC-675 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-25Modify the incorrect return codefengyuanxing1-2/+1
Change-Id: I5d00cb478f040219299284e77330a38e79a7402b Issue-ID: VFC-677 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>
2018-01-25Remove unused codefengyuanxing1-21/+18
Change-Id: Ie92b00114a901cda3d2b954a23bd7bc170f5065e Issue-ID: VFC-677 Signed-off-by: fengyuanxing <feng.yuanxing@zte.com.cn>